1、本科毕业论文(20 届)基于 WEB 的物流管理系统的设计与实现所在学院 专业班级 计算机科学与技术 学生姓名 学号 指导教师 职称 完成日期 年 月 原 创 性 声 明本人郑重声明:本人所呈交的毕业论文,是在指导老师的指导下独立进行研究所取得的成果。毕业论文中凡引用他人已经发表或未发表的成果、数据、观点等,均已明确注明出处。除文中已经注明引用的内容外,不包含任何其他个人或集体已经发表或撰写过的科研成果。对本文的研究成果做出重要贡献的个人和集体,均已在文中以明确方式标明。本声明的法律责任由本人承担。论文作者签名: 日 期: 关于毕业论文使用授权的声明本人在指导老师指导下所完成的论文及相关的资料
2、(包括图纸、试验记录、原始数据、实物照片、图片、录音带、设计手稿等),知识产权归属吕梁学院。本人完全了解吕梁学院有关保存、使用毕业论文的规定,同意学校保存或向国家有关部门或机构送交论文的纸质版和电子版,允许论文被查阅和借阅;本人授权吕梁学院可以将本毕业论文的全部或部分内容编入有关数据库进行检索,可以采用任何复制手段保存和汇编本毕业论文。如果发表相关成果,一定征得指导教师同意,且第一署名单位为吕梁学院。本人离校后使用毕业论文或与该论文直接相关的学术论文或成果时,第一署名单位仍然为吕梁学院。论文作者签名: 日 期: 指导老师签名: 日 期: 摘 要我 们 处 于 一 个 网 络 快 速 发 展 的
3、 时 代 , 方 便 快 捷 的 网 络 给 人 们 生 活 带 来 了 方方 面 面 的 影 响 。 网 络 购 物 已 经 越 来 越 被 人 们 所 接 受 , 对 于 那 些 忙 于 工 作 的 白 领 、学 生 等 来 说 , 足 不 出 户 即 可 实 现 购 物 , 不 仅 节 省 了 时 间 , 同 时 也 满 足 了 自 己 的需 要 。 双 十 一 淘 宝 的 销 售 记 录 已 经 是 个 对 此 最 好 的 诠 释 。 但 是 数 量 如 此 之 大 的各 色 货 物 要 到 达 客 户 的 手 中 需 要 四 通 八 达 的 物 流 配 送 , 而 且 要 想 保 证
4、 物 流 的准 确 配 送 必 须 配 备 相 应 的 物 流 管 理 系 统 , 用 来 管 理 和 记 录 客 户 的 信 息 以 及 订 单的 托 运 信 息 和 公 司 内 部 的 配 送 资 源 的 调 配 比 如 司 机 、 车 辆 等 等 。本 系 统 采 用 MVC 框 架 , 运 用 JSP 技 术 编 写 , 开 发 平 台 为 MyEclipse。本 系 统 主 要 服 务 于 物 流 公 司 的 内 部 员 工 , 帮 助 员 工 管 理 繁 杂 的 客 户 的 相 关信 息 , 登 记 客 户 的 下 单 情 况 , 根 据 客 户 的 下 单 情 况 为 货 物 分
5、 配 配 送 的 车 辆 。 公司 内 部 的 物 流 配 送 管 理 员 根 据 公 司 的 配 送 需 求 新 增 或 删 除 物 流 配 员 。关 键 词 : 物 流 管 理 ; 配 送 ; MyEclipseAbstractWe are in a network era of rapid development, has brought people life convenient network effects in all its aspects. Online shopping has been more and more accepted by people, for thos
6、e busy with work of white-collar workers, students, etc., never leave home shopping can be realized, not only saves time, but also meet the needs of his own. Double tenth a taobao sales record is the best interpretation. But so large number of all kinds of goods arrive at the hands of customers need
7、 convenient logistics distribution, and to guarantee the accuracy of the logistics and distribution must be equipped with corresponding logistics management system, to manage and record customer information and order the shipping information and internal distribution of resources such as driver, veh
8、icle and so on.This system USES the MVC framework, using the JSP technology, development platform for MyEclipse.This system mainly in the service of logistics companys internal staff, help staff to manage complex information about customers, registered customer orders, according to the customers ord
9、er for goods allocation and distribution of the vehicle. Companys internal logistics manager according to the distribution of the company needs new or delete logistics manning.Key words: logistics management; Distribution; MyEclipse目 录第 1 章 绪 论 .- 1 -1.1 开发背景及意义 .- 1 -1.1.1 开发背景 .- 1 -1.1.2 开发意义 .-
10、1 -1.2 发展现状 .- 1 -1.2.1 国内发展现状 .- 1 -1.2.2 国外发展现状 .- 2 -第 2 章 系统分析 .- 3 -2.1 可行性分析 .- 3 -2.1.1 技术可行性 .- 3 -2.1.2 社会可行性 .- 3 -2.1.3 经济可行性 .- 3 -2.2 需求分析 .- 4 -2.2.1 功能需求 .- 4 -2.2.2 性能需求 .- 4 -2.3 业务流程分析 .- 5 -2.3.1 业务描述 .- 5 -2.3.2 业务流程图 .- 5 -第 3 章 系统设计 .- 6 -3.1 系统设计原则 .- 6 -3.2 物流管理系统功能模块图 .- 6 -
11、3.3 主要模块程序流程图分析 .- 7 -3.3.1 登录程序流程分析 .- 7 -3.3.2 系统程序流程分析 .- 8 -3.4 数据库的设计 .- 9 -3.4.1 数据库概念结构设计 .- 9 -3.4.2 数据库表设计 .- 11 -3.4.3 数据表逻辑设计 .- 15 -第 4 章 系统实现 .- 16 -4.1 支撑环境 .- 16 -4.1.1 软件环境 .- 16 -4.1.2 硬件环境 .- 16 -4.2 登录模块 .- 16 -4.2.1 管理员登录 .- 16 -4.2.2 用户登录 .- 17 -4.2.3 用户登录成功界面 .- 17 -4.3 用户个人信息设
12、置模块 .- 18 -4.4 人事管理 .- 19 -4.5 货物信息管理的实现 .- 20 -4.6 车辆信息管理实现 .- 21 -第 5 章 系统测试 .- 24 -5.1 系统测试目的与意义 .- 24 -5.2 测试环境 .- 24 -5.3 测试过程 .- 24 -5.4 软件测试结论 .- 25 -5.4.1 软件能力 .- 25 -5.4.2 测试结论 .- 26 -第 6 章 总结与展望 .- 27 -6.1 总结 .- 27 -6.2 系统展望 .- 27 -参考文献 .- 28 -致 谢 .- 29 - 1 -第 1 章 绪 论1.1 开发背景及意义1.1.1 开发背景当
13、今世界各种各样的数据极度膨胀,大量的数据充斥在我们的周围,特别是对于企业来说。企业盈利模式的特殊性决定了一个企业要想在竞争日益激烈的市场中站稳脚跟,必须掌握第一手的数据,深刻了解客户的需求,对客户的相关数据进行及时准确的保存和更新。保证将客户需求转换为有效的数据告知企业员工,从而才能保证企业更好的为用户服务。所以为了更好的为用户服务,也为了规范公司内部的管理,给公司避免一些由于客户信息的丢失、存储错误给公司带来的不必要的损失,为公司赢取更多的利润我们设计开发了本系统。1.1.2 开发意义随着国内信息化步伐的加快,网络已成为人们生活中必不可少的一部分,网上购物也越来越普遍。前段时间双十一淘宝网创
14、下的销售业绩至今让人唏嘘不已,人们在购买商品上已经越来越依靠网络,特别是当今的 90 后和 80 后,大量的宅男宅女在我们的生活中层出不穷,另外大部分的企业白领,金领等等由于工作繁忙没有太多的时间来到实体店进行购物,所以繁重的购物重担就落在了各种网店上,然而足不出户、送货上门已成为一种购物的主流模式,但是数额如此巨大的商品要如何从卖家的店铺送往全国各地,而且还毫无差错呢?这就需要有一个高效的物流管理系统,来实现货物的准确配送,同时也提供给客户一个有效了解自己托运货物的运送状态。物流管理系统的开发可以有效地管理货物配送数据,信息更新及时高效,不易出错,从而也有利于企业赢得顾客的好品,为下次交易做
15、好铺垫。1.2 发展现状1.2.1 国内发展现状目前,国内物流信息网为了满足大量网上购物者的需求同时也受国内经济发展的驱动,数量如雨后春笋般的扩增。物流管理系统在现代的物流行业内充当着重要角色,极大的方便了国内的物流企业之间、物流企业和客户之间的交流与合作,同时国内物流管理系统的技术水平以及运行模式也得到了充分的提高和完善。并- 2 -逐步与国外先进的物流管理系统接轨。最近几年,许多企业特别是类似于淘宝店,唯品会等公司,销售业绩很大一部分是依靠网络,而网上购物就离不开物流配送,只有能及时、准确、保质、保量的将物品送到消费者或者委托人手中,我们才能获得客户的认可,从而成为客户的首选对象,进而获取
16、利润。在此背景下,物流管理系统就对物流信息的管理提供了极大的方便,给了客户一个平台,让他们能够随时随地了解自己的物品配送状态,做到心中有数。1.2.2 国外发展现状在国外,很多国家经济十分发达,譬如美国、英国等,他们的互联网技术也十分先进,发展程度高,所以与之配套的物流技术与现代的互联网技术以结合并付诸实践多年,从 20 世纪 60、70 年代起,国外就产生了许多新兴的物流管理模式,其中 MRP(Manufacturing Resource Plan)即制造资源计划,ERP(Enterprise Resource Plan)即企业资源计划是最具代表性与特色性的。- 3 -第 2 章 系统分析2
17、.1 可行性分析可行性研究主要是论证开发项目是否可行,是否能够依据自身所学的相关技术开发出所需系统。因此可行性分析也相当于是一个简化的系统分析过程,通过科学的论证,为项目的实施提供建议和决策依据,降低项目失败带来的各方面损失的风险。我们可以从以下几个方面来进行可行性分析。2.1.1 技术可行性技术可行性是分析根据现下掌握的与系统相关的技术能否根据需求分析实现本系统,软硬件能否满足本系统的需求。在软件方面,Navicat for MySQL 可以很好的对数据库 Mysql 进行管理,很好的连接数据库,能够更加友好的为用户服务,可视化的窗口也可以让我们更加清楚的了解数据库的存储模式,简单灵活方便快
18、捷。MyEclipse 是个我们非常熟悉的工具,他的安装与使用我们都曾系统的学习过,所以软件方面已一切就绪。在硬件方面,随着科技的不断推进,计算机的硬件已有了飞速的发展,硬件的价格也由于越来越成熟的技术支持变得低廉,这些优质的计算机硬件性能已经足够满足本系统对计算机硬件的需求。所以本物流管理系统的开发在技术上是可行的。2.1.2 社会可行性本系统开发不论是前期还是后期都是根据企业的需求有针对性的设计,并未违反相关的法律,也没有对他人的专利进行抄袭,所以不构成侵权。所以本系统具有社会可行性。2.1.3 经济可行性现在,计算机在生活中的使用已经十分普遍,且由于科技的不断进步,计算机的性能相比以前已经十分优越,完全能够满足本系统的要求,开发本系统不需要额外的大型服务器等。而本系统的开发为公司的物流管理提供了极大的方便为此主要表现有以下几个方面:第一,本系统的运行可以节省人力和时间。第二,本系统的运行可以节省许多资源;第三,本系统的开发可以使客户和企业人员随时随地了解货物的托运情况;
Copyright © 2018-2021 Wenke99.com All rights reserved
工信部备案号:浙ICP备20026746号-2
公安局备案号:浙公网安备33038302330469号
本站为C2C交文档易平台,即用户上传的文档直接卖给下载用户,本站只是网络服务中间平台,所有原创文档下载所得归上传人所有,若您发现上传作品侵犯了您的权利,请立刻联系网站客服并提供证据,平台将在3个工作日内予以改正。